Nova Scotia Health System Pandemic Influenza Plan

 

The government of Nova Scotia is monitoring and responding to H1N1 Flu Virus (Human Swine Flu) in Nova Scotia.

For the latest update and general information about H1N1 Flu Virus visit Health Promotion and Protection H1N1 Flu Web page.

 

This plan is a framework for directing the work of the government and other provincial health system stakeholders Leading up to and during a pandemic. It will ensure that when an influenza pandemic occurs our healthcare system will be in the best position possible to manage it.

The goal of planning is to minimize serious illness and overall death, and to minimize societal disruption, in the event of an influenza pandemic. The scope of the plan includes:

  • guiding health sector response during an emergency
  • establishing a process to manage issues resolution
  • establishing communication processes for sharing information with stakeholders and the public, and addressing their concerns
  • clarifying command and control structures.
